Pennington man killed in crash

A Pennington man was killed and a Bemidji man was injured after a crash Wednesday morning in Pennington.

Beltrami County Chief Deputy Jarrett Walton says that 59-year-old Jeffrey Imhoff of Bemidji and 44-year-old Neil C. Cutbank of Pennington collided in the southbound lane of the Scenic Highway.

Cutbank was transported by ambulance to Cass Lake IHS where was later pronounced dead.

Walton says Cutbank was not wearing his seat belt when responders arrived.

Imhoff was transported to Sanford Bemidji with non-life-threatening injuries.

The Ramsey County Medical Examiner’s Office will conduct the autopsy and the Minnesota State Patrol will reconstruct the accident as part of the ongoing investigation.

The Leech Lake Tribal Police Department, Cass Lake Ambulance, Cass Lake Fire Department and the Minnesota State Patrol assisted at the scene.
